KgSolomon1- The 3M PI-III RC (pn 05933) is NOT all that strong, so you might need something stronger than that. You won't remove serious marring (even "swirls) from many hard b/c paints with that product and a PC. *I* use the 1Z Ultra, but then if the surface is that bad I usually use a rotary. Trying to do rotary work with a PC is more problematic than many might think, IMO.



I'd be careful using really harsh compounds with a PC, it doesn't have the heat/speed to break them down the way they are designed to, so you can get constantly harsh effects instead of diminishing abrasive-type effects. This is one reason why the rotary is sometimes SAFER for serious correction than a PC.
